机器学习新手入门:Jupyter Notebook快速指南

需积分: 43 20 下载量 139 浏览量 更新于2024-09-08 1 收藏 753KB DOCX 举报
Jupyter Notebook是【人工智能头条】推荐的一项必备工具,尤其对机器学习新手至关重要。这款开源的Web应用程序因其丰富的功能和易用性,已经成为数据科学和机器学习项目开发的标准之一。以下是关于Jupyter Notebook的一些关键知识点: 1. **定义与特点**: Jupyter Notebook是一种交互式编程环境,它集成了文本编辑、代码运行、即时反馈和可视化的强大工具。它支持多种编程语言,如Python、R和SQL,使数据清洗、统计建模、机器学习模型开发和数据可视化等工作流程变得更加直观。 2. **优点**: - **代码记录与协作**:Notebook允许用户在一个文档中记录代码、注释和结果,方便团队协作和版本控制。 - **单元格结构**:Notebook以单元格形式组织代码,每个单元格独立执行,有助于迭代开发和调试。 - **实时反馈**:用户可以直接在代码执行过程中观察结果,提高了效率和调试能力。 - **教学与演示**:由于其交互性和视觉呈现,Jupyter Notebook非常适合教学和演示复杂的概念。 3. **安装与使用**: - **基础要求**:要使用Jupyter Notebook,首先需要安装Python,推荐使用2.7或3.3及以上版本。 - **推荐工具**:新用户推荐使用Anaconda,它包含了Python、Jupyter Notebook以及众多数据科学库,简化了安装过程。 - **下载安装**:可以从Anaconda官网下载安装包,地址为<https://jupyter.readthedocs.org>。 4. **应用领域**: Jupyter Notebook在Kaggle这样的数据挖掘竞赛中广泛应用,参赛者经常使用它进行数据探索、特征工程和模型训练。 Jupyter Notebook为机器学习新手提供了一个高效且友好的环境,无论是初学者还是经验丰富的数据科学家,都能从中受益。通过安装和掌握这款工具,新手能够更快地入门机器学习,并在实践中提升技能。